To give you a little background on this post let me share what I am trying to do:

One of the reasons for buying a wide lens (Askar ACL200) was to be able to play with composition for my Astro images in more widefield pictures first.
I have started to do panoramas of the night sky that I want to use in Nina for the Framing Wizzard. Those Panos should be as detailled as possible so that I do not miss too much of Nebulosity in the final composition.

I currently do one hour per panel with an ALP-T filter and later will do another hour with a Sii filter.

Editing of the panels should be efficient and kind of reproducible as in good nights 8 or more panels are possible, although currently I am happy when I get half of that number...

Here's my process:

Do 20 subs  at 3minutes, gain 200 with my IMX571 based OSC Camera
Check and weed out subs with blink and subframe selector
stack images with wbpp with "Maximum Quality" preset, process separate RGB channels, disable blue channel processing (green and blue for Sii)
combine channels as HOO (or SHO)
run ABE with substraction
Adjust background in GHS ("linear" Low Clip to 0.000001)
Pre-Stretch for stars in GHS ("Arcsinh" Stretch Factor 7 works OK for my 3min exposures @F4)
Run StarXTerminator (Unscreen Stars) on Image, put the stars away
Undo StarXTerminator and the PreStretch
Stretch Image in GHS , switch to Log scale and try to get the maximum to the line in the middle of the 1st quarter make the historamm as wide as possible without it climbing up again at the right corner, it should roughly go down in a linear manner from the maximum.
Apply NoiseXTerminator Denoise 0.8, Detail 0.2
Save Main Image and Stars in 16bit Tif for PS

In PS open both images, open main image with Adobe Camera Raw and edit the picture so that the Nebulae show well with details and bring background levels in the range of 20-30.
Run Topaz Denoise
Sharpen if necessary (I use APF-R)
Then add the stars to the image and save.

Here are a few results in HOO done at >90%moon, is there another efficient way that gets better results?
